4. Operating Instructions

The Miele Triflex HX1 Pro features a 3-in-1 design for adaptable cleaning and a simple one-switch turn-on control.

4.1 Powering On and Off

To turn the vacuum cleaner on, press the power button once. To turn it off, press the power button again. The vacuum cleaner offers three power levels, which can be adjusted via the touch controls on the power unit.

4.2 3-in-1 Design Modes

The Triflex HX1 Pro can be configured into three distinct modes:

  • Comfort Mode: The power unit is positioned at the bottom, near the electrobrush. This configuration provides a low center of gravity, making it feel lighter for ergonomic cleaning of large floor areas. The vacuum stands upright unaided in this mode.

  • Reach Mode: The power unit is positioned at the top, near the handle. This mode offers maximum reach, ideal for cleaning ceiling corners, high shelves, or underneath low furniture.

  • Compact Mode: The power unit is detached from the wand and used as a handheld unit. This mode is suitable for quick clean-ups, cleaning car interiors, upholstery, or tight spaces using the included accessories.

4.3 Multi Floor XXL Electrobrush

The vacuum is equipped with an 11-inch Multi Floor XXL Electrobrush featuring BrilliantLight LED lighting and automatic floor detection. This ensures effective and quick cleaning across all floor types, including bare floors, carpets, and rugs. The LED light illuminates dust and debris, making it easier to spot and clean.

4.4 Battery Life

With two exchangeable, rechargeable VARTA Lithium-Ion batteries, the vacuum provides up to 2 x 60 minutes (120 minutes total) run-time, allowing for extensive cleaning without interruption.

5. Maintenance

Regular maintenance ensures optimal performance and longevity of your Miele Triflex HX1 Pro.

5.1 Emptying the Dust Bin

The dust bin has a capacity of 0.5 liters. It should be emptied regularly, especially when the 'MAX' line is reached. To empty, detach the power unit, locate the release mechanism, and carefully open the bin over a waste receptacle. It may be tricky initially, but becomes easier with practice.

5.2 Filter Maintenance

The Triflex HX1 Pro features a maintenance-free HEPA Lifetime Filter, designed for 99.999% dust retention. While the HEPA filter itself does not require washing, other filters within the dust bin system do require attention:

  • Fine Filter: This narrow white filter should be gently shaken to remove accumulated dust. Do NOT get it wet.
  • Pre-Filter: This larger filter should be lightly knocked to dislodge dirt. A fine brush (e.g., a toothbrush) can be used to clean it.
  • The clear plastic container that houses the filters can be washed with water. Ensure it is completely dry before reassembling.

It is recommended to clean these components every time the dust bin is emptied to prevent buildup and maintain suction performance.

5.3 Cleaning the Electrobrush

Periodically check the Multi Floor XXL Electrobrush for tangled hair or fibers. If the brush roll becomes fouled, it can impede performance. Carefully remove any obstructions. If larger particles or paper pieces are picked up, they may block the power head, requiring removal of the power head to clear the debris from the duct.

6. Troubleshooting

This section addresses common issues you might encounter with your Miele Triflex HX1 Pro.

ProblemPossible CauseSolution
Vacuum does not turn on.Battery not charged or not properly inserted.Ensure battery is fully charged and correctly seated in the power unit.
Reduced suction power.Dust bin full; filters clogged; blockage in wand or power head.Empty dust bin. Clean fine filter and pre-filter. Check wand and power head for obstructions.
Electrobrush not spinning.Brush roll tangled with hair/fibers; power head blocked.Clean brush roll. Remove power head and clear any debris from the duct.
Battery not charging.Charging cable or docking station malfunction; battery not properly connected.Ensure charging cable is securely connected. Try charging the second battery to isolate the issue. Contact Miele service if problem persists.
Vacuum is heavy to push (in Comfort Mode).This is a perception, but ensure the power unit is correctly positioned at the bottom for Comfort Mode.Verify correct assembly for Comfort Mode. The design aims for ergonomic balance.
